Hello all! Just a little background, My shooting consists of a 1,000 yard range plinking and white tails out to 200 yards and hopes and dreams of getting out west besides than just with my bow. What's everyone's opinions on the Seekins havak vs the ridgeline? I feel the action on the Seekins would be a better investment and one to keep around long term but do kinda fancy the ridgeline a little. Also I'm torn between the 28 nosler and 300 wm I really have this churning in my heart for the 28 nosler but I don't see much of a big following behind it. So what is your opinion? Caliber, rifle?
 
I'd personally choose the Seekins over the Ridgeline for better value. CA seem to be hit and miss with rumors of poor service. Seekins is known for quality and good service.

As for cartridge, of the two you mention I'd strongly suggest the 300 for barrel life. However, for your use, I'd strongly consider a smaller cartridge for barrel life and you 200 yard whitetail needs. A 6.5 Creedmoor (I don't have one) or something on those lines will be a far better fit in my opinion.

Seekins, and maybe in a 6.5 PRC? Either of the calibers you Listed seem overkill for your needs. I expect you'll find the 6.5 PRC much more pleasant for your 1000 yard plinking and more than adequate on whitetail to much further than 200.
